                 Plot lies at the core of the framework. Each plot takes place in a specific context and involves
               some entities, while different plots are semantically related in terms of sequence or overlap. In
               a specific plot annotation area within an image, a dynamics is normally used to present dynamic
               features of the plot. The descriptive framework, as a whole, is an abstract semantic annotation
               model and accomplishes the semantic description and annotation by mapping annotated objects
               onto the abstract model. Plot constitutes the core of the annotation framework and corresponds to
               the Body of OAC in image annotation.
                 In detail, temporal semantic relations between plots contain nextplot, lastplot, overlaps,
               meets, starts, during, finishes, equal. In addition to the above relations, other obscure and
               abstract spatio-temporal semantic relations can also be identified in plots. This paper places
               TemporalSpatialEntity under the category of Entity. To meet the need for annotation of spatio-
               temporal information in narrative images, this paper divides TemporalSpatialEntity into Place and
               TemporalThing, which are respectively further divided into two types-Concrete(ConcretePlace,
               ConcreteTemporalThing)and Abstract(AbstractPlace, AbstractTemporalThing). Dynamics is
               another indispensable element in the model. As a core sub-category in the process of annotation,
               Action has two object properties, namely hasActor and hasRecipient;the former being the
               agent of the action while the latter the patient. At the same time, Dynamics can also have a
               type(DyanmicsType). Context is a special item in the plot annotation of narrative images, and
               it provides the annotation model with additional extension ability. Instead of being directly
               accessible from image, information involved in context is hidden behind the image, yet helpful in
               understanding the image.
                 To represent the complex relations of overlap between different annotated areas within an
               image, this paper puts forward OAC extended vocabularies, including no-overlap, complete-
               overlap, inclusiveness, and partial-overlap. In the end, this paper performs a semantic annotation
               experiment on Dunhuang narrative murals, using an image semantic annotation tool embedded
               with the model, and the annotation data is converted and stored in the form of RDF triples. The
               experiment verifies the model’s reliability and applicability.
